BEFORE YOU START

Safe installation and operation of this appliance requires common sense, however, we are required by the Canadian Safety Standards and ANSI Standards to make you aware of the following:

INSTALLATION AND REPAIR SHOULD BE DONE BY A QUALI- FIED SERVICE PERSON. THE AP- PLIANCE SHOULD BE INSPECT- ED BEFORE USE AND AT LEAST ANNUALLY BY A PROFESSIONAL SERVICE PERSON. MORE FRE- QUENT CLEANING MAY BE RE- QUIRED DUE TO EXCESSIVE LINT FROM CARPETING, BEDDING MATERIAL, ETC. IT IS IMPERA- TIVE THAT CONTROL COMPART- MENTS, BURNERS AND CIRCU- LATING AIR PASSAGEWAYS OF THE APPLIANCE BE KEPT CLEAN.

DUE TO HIGH TEMPERATURES, THE APPLIANCE SHOULD BE LO- CATED OUT OF TRAFFIC AND AWAY FROM FURNITURE AND DRAPERIES.

WARNING: FAILURE TO INSTALL THIS APPLIANCE CORRECTLY MAY CAUSE A SERIOUS HOUSE FIRE AND WILL VOID YOUR WAR- RANTY.

CHILDREN AND ADULTS SHOULD BE ALERTED TO THE HAZARDS OF HIGH SURFACE TEMPERA- TURES, ESPECIALLY THE FIRE- PLACE GLASS, AND SHOULD STAY AWAY TO AVOID BURNS OR CLOTHING IGNITION.

YOUNG CHILDREN SHOULD BE CAREFULLY SUPERVISED WHEN THEY ARE IN THE SAME ROOM AS THE APPLIANCE.

CLOTHING OR OTHER FLAMMA- BLE MATERIAL SHOULD NOT BE PLACED ON OR NEAR THE APPLI- ANCE.

The ULTIMATE Freestanding Gas Stove must be installed in accordance with these instruc- tions. Carefully read all the instructions in this manual first. Consult the "authority having juris- diction" to determine the need for a permit prior to starting the installation.

GENERAL SAFETY

INFORMATION

1)The appliance installation must conform with local codes or, in the absence of local codes, with the current Canadian or Nation- al Gas Codes, CAN1-B149 or ANSI-223.1 Installation Codes.

2)The appliance when installed, must be elec- trically grounded in accordance with local codes, or in the absence of local codes with the current National Electrical Code, ANSI/ NFPA 70 or CSA C22.1 Canadian Electrical Code.

3)This appliance is Listed for bedroom instal- lations when used with a Listed Millivolt Thermostat. Some areas may have further requirements, check local codes before installation.

4)This appliance is Listed for Alcove installa- tions, maintain minimum Alcove clearances as follows, minimum ceiling height of 66", minimum width of 48" and a maximum depth of 36".

5)This unit is not approved for installation into a mobile home.

6)See general construction and assembly instructions.

7)This appliance must be connected to a vent and terminate to the outside of the building envelope. Never vent to another room or inside a building.

8)Inspect the venting system annually for blockage and any signs of deterioration.

9)Any safety glass removed for servicing must be replaced prior to operating the appliance.

10)To prevent injury, do not allow anyone who is unfamiliar with the operation to use the fireplace.

11)Wear gloves and safety glasses for pro- tection while doing required maintenance.

12)Under no circumstances should this appli- ance be modified. Parts that have to be removed for servicing should be replaced prior to operating this appliance.

13)Installation and any repairs to this appliance should be done by a qualified service per- son. A professional service person should be called to inspect this appliance annually. Make it a practice to have all of your gas appliances checked annually.

14)Do not strike the glass door.

15)Under no circumstances should any solid fuels (wood, paper, cardboard, coal, etc.) be used in this appliance.

16)The appliance area must be kept clear and free of combustible materials, (gases and other flammable vapours and liquids).

17)Do not connect this gas appliance to chim- ney flue serving a separate sold-fuel burn- ing appliance.

18)WARNING: Operation of this appliance when not connected to a properly installed and maintained venting system or tampering with the blocked vent shutoff system can result in carbon monoxide (CO) poisoning and possible death.

19)This appliance needs fresh air for safe operation and must be installed so there are provisions for adequate combustion and ventilation air.
